Forráskód Böngészése

完善存储桶配置文件

locky 3 éve
szülő
commit
5c8d2f1f92

+ 4 - 1
Ansjer/cn_config/config_formal.py

@@ -125,7 +125,10 @@ TUTK_PUSH_DOMAIN = 'http://push.iotcplatform.com/tpns'
 
 # aws api key
 AWS_ARN_S3 = 'arn:aws-cn:s3'
-AVATAR_BUCKET = 'avatar-cn'
 REGION_NAME = 'cn-northwest-1'
 ACCESS_KEY_ID = 'AKIA2MMWBR4DSFG67DTG'
 SECRET_ACCESS_KEY = '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'
+
+# 存储桶名
+AVATAR_BUCKET = 'avatar-cn'         # 头像存储桶
+LOG_BUCKET = 'ansjer-statres'       # 日志存储桶

+ 4 - 1
Ansjer/cn_config/config_test.py

@@ -137,7 +137,10 @@ TUTK_PUSH_DOMAIN = 'http://push.iotcplatform.com/tpns'
 
 # aws api key
 AWS_ARN_S3 = 'arn:aws-cn:s3'
-AVATAR_BUCKET = 'avatar-cn'
 REGION_NAME = 'cn-northwest-1'
 ACCESS_KEY_ID = 'AKIA2MMWBR4DSFG67DTG'
 SECRET_ACCESS_KEY = '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'
+
+# 存储桶名
+AVATAR_BUCKET = 'avatar-cn'         # 头像存储桶
+LOG_BUCKET = 'ansjer-statres'       # 日志存储桶

+ 4 - 1
Ansjer/local_config/config_local.py

@@ -58,7 +58,10 @@ TUTK_PUSH_DOMAIN = 'http://push.iotcplatform.com/tpns'
 
 # aws api key
 AWS_ARN_S3 = 'arn:aws-cn:s3'
-AVATAR_BUCKET = 'avatar-cn'
 REGION_NAME = 'cn-northwest-1'
 ACCESS_KEY_ID = 'AKIA2MMWBR4DSFG67DTG'
 SECRET_ACCESS_KEY = '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'
+
+# 存储桶名
+AVATAR_BUCKET = 'avatar-cn'         # 头像存储桶
+LOG_BUCKET = 'ansjer-statres'       # 日志存储桶

+ 4 - 1
Ansjer/us_config/config_formal.py

@@ -125,7 +125,10 @@ TUTK_PUSH_DOMAIN = 'http://push.iotcplatform.com/tpns'
 
 # aws api key
 AWS_ARN_S3 = 'arn:aws:s3'
-AVATAR_BUCKET = 'avatar-us'
 REGION_NAME = 'us-east-1'
 ACCESS_KEY_ID = 'AKIA2E67UIMD45Y3HL53'
 SECRET_ACCESS_KEY = '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'
+
+# 存储桶名
+AVATAR_BUCKET = 'avatar-us'         # 头像存储桶
+LOG_BUCKET = 'ansjer-statres'       # 日志存储桶

+ 4 - 1
Ansjer/us_config/config_test.py

@@ -136,7 +136,10 @@ TUTK_PUSH_DOMAIN = 'http://push.iotcplatform.com/tpns'
 
 # aws api key
 AWS_ARN_S3 = 'arn:aws:s3'
-AVATAR_BUCKET = 'avatar-us'
 REGION_NAME = 'us-east-1'
 ACCESS_KEY_ID = 'AKIA2E67UIMD45Y3HL53'
 SECRET_ACCESS_KEY = '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'
+
+# 存储桶名
+AVATAR_BUCKET = 'avatar-us'         # 头像存储桶
+LOG_BUCKET = 'ansjer-statres'       # 日志存储桶

+ 3 - 2
Controller/AppLogController.py

@@ -7,7 +7,8 @@ import botocore
 import oss2
 from django.views.generic.base import View
 
-from Ansjer.config import OSS_STS_ACCESS_KEY, OSS_STS_ACCESS_SECRET, REGION_NAME, ACCESS_KEY_ID, SECRET_ACCESS_KEY
+from Ansjer.config import OSS_STS_ACCESS_KEY, OSS_STS_ACCESS_SECRET, REGION_NAME, ACCESS_KEY_ID, SECRET_ACCESS_KEY, \
+    LOG_BUCKET
 from Model.models import AppLogModel
 from Object.ResponseObject import ResponseObject
 from Object.TokenObject import TokenObject
@@ -66,7 +67,7 @@ class AppLogView(View):
         response_url = aws_s3_client.generate_presigned_url(
             ClientMethod='put_object',
             Params={
-                'Bucket': 'ansjer-statres',
+                'Bucket': LOG_BUCKET,
                 'Key': obj
             },
             ExpiresIn=3600